>gnl|CDD|238125 cd00204, ANK, ankyrin repeats; ankyrin repeats mediate
protein-protein interactions in very diverse families of
proteins. The number of ANK repeats in a protein can
range from 2 to over 20 (ankyrins, for example). ANK
repeats may occur in combinations with other types of
domains. The structural repeat unit contains two
antiparallel helices and a beta-hairpin, repeats are
stacked in a superhelical arrangement; this alignment
contains 4 consecutive repeats.

>gnl|CDD|233161 TIGR00870, trp, transient-receptor-potential calcium channel
protein. The Transient Receptor Potential Ca2+ Channel
(TRP-CC) Family (TC. 1.A.4)The TRP-CC family has also
been called the store-operated calcium channel (SOC)
family. The prototypical members include the Drosophila
retinal proteinsTRP and TRPL (Montell and Rubin, 1989;
Hardie and Minke, 1993). SOC members of the family
mediate the entry of extracellular Ca2+ into cells in
responseto depletion of intracellular Ca2+ stores
(Clapham, 1996) and agonist stimulated production of
inositol-1,4,5 trisphosphate (IP3). One member of the
TRP-CCfamily, mammalian Htrp3, has been shown to form a
tight complex with the IP3 receptor (TC #1.A.3.2.1).
This interaction is apparently required for IP3
tostimulate Ca2+ release via Htrp3. The vanilloid
receptor subtype 1 (VR1), which is the receptor for
capsaicin (the ?hot? ingredient in chili peppers) and
servesas a heat-activated ion channel in the pain
pathway (Caterina et al., 1997), is also a member of
this family. The stretch-inhibitable non-selective
cation channel(SIC) is identical to the vanilloid
receptor throughout all of its first 700 residues, but
it exhibits a different sequence in its last 100
residues. VR1 and SICtransport monovalent cations as
well as Ca2+. VR1 is about 10x more permeable to Ca2+
than to monovalent ions. Ca2+ overload probably causes
cell deathafter chronic exposure to capsaicin.
(McCleskey and Gold, 1999) [Transport and binding
proteins, Cations and iron carrying compounds].

>gnl|CDD|200936 pfam00023, Ank, Ankyrin repeat. Ankyrins are multifunctional
adaptors that link specific proteins to the
membrane-associated, spectrin- actin cytoskeleton. This
repeat-domain is a 'membrane-binding' domain of up to 24
repeated units, and it mediates most of the protein's
binding activities. Repeats 13-24 are especially active,
with known sites of interaction for the Na/K ATPase,
Cl/HCO(3) anion exchanger, voltage-gated sodium channel,
clathrin heavy chain and L1 family cell adhesion
molecules. The ANK repeats are found to form a
contiguous spiral stack such that ion transporters like
the anion exchanger associate in a large central cavity
formed by the ANK repeat spiral, while clathrin and cell
adhesion molecules associate with specific regions
outside this cavity.

>gnl|CDD|197603 smart00248, ANK, ankyrin repeats. Ankyrin repeats are about 33
amino acids long and occur in at least four consecutive
copies. They are involved in protein-protein
interactions. The core of the repeat seems to be an
helix-loop-helix structure.

>gnl|CDD|132847 cd07208, Pat_hypo_Ecoli_yjju_like, Hypothetical patatin similar to
yjju protein of Escherichia coli. Patatin-like
phospholipase similar to yjju protein of Escherichia
coli. This family predominantly consists of bacterial
patatin glycoproteins, and some representatives from
eukaryotes and archaea. The patatin protein accounts
for up to 40% of the total soluble protein in potato
tubers. Patatin is a storage protein, but it also has
the enzymatic activity of a lipid acyl hydrolase,
catalyzing the cleavage of fatty acids from membrane
lipids. Members of this family have also been found in
vertebrates.
